National Monument to Migration, the Welcome Wall, ceremony at Australian National Maritime Museum celebrates multiculturalism by honouring migrants’ stories and paying tribute to our migration heritage. It was a wonderful ceremony attended by 1300 guests with over 400 names of migrants added to the Welcome Wall. Also attended a private guided tour of HMAS Onslow at the museum with Chief of Navy, Vice Admiral Mark Hammond AO who was training aboard Onslow as a young Lieutenant and will be Chief of Defence Force in July.
